Teachers' Private Capital
Teachers' Private Capital is the private investment department of the Ontario Teachers' Pension Plan. It has participated in numerous transactions in Canada, the United States, and Europe. Investments include Acorn Care & Education, Alliance Laundry Systems, and others.

How does Teachers' Private Capital source proprietary deal flow?
As a large pension fund's direct investment arm, Teachers' Private Capital leverages relationships with advisors, industry networks, and co-investors. Its permanent capital base allows it to pursue bilateral deals and lead transactions, often in collaboration with other institutional investors. The firm's reputation also attracts direct approaches from companies seeking long-term partners.
